
Francois Magimel contributed to open source projects by improving documentation quality and user-facing messaging across several repositories. On MichaIng/DietPi, he used Shell scripting to correct display mode update messages during Raspberry Pi firmware updates, ensuring clarity and reducing user confusion. For home-assistant/home-assistant.io, he enhanced onboarding documentation by refining grammar and punctuation, supporting a smoother user experience. In qmk/qmk_firmware, Francois applied technical writing and code review skills in C and Markdown to clean up documentation, fix misspellings, and standardize formatting. His work focused on incremental, detail-oriented improvements that increased reliability, readability, and maintainability for both users and contributors.
